Brief Summary: Colorectal cancer CRC is the second common cause of death in the Western world and is very increasing in Japan Fecal occult blood test FOBT is used routinely for CRC screening which has been shown to reduce the incidence morbidity and mortality of CRC However there is a need to develop a novel method to improve sensitivity The investigators reported that Fecal COX-2 assay one of fecal RNA test is potentially useful for colorectal cancer screening Gastroenterology 127 422-427 2004 So the investigators planed to compare fecal RNA test with FOBT for detecting colorectal cancer and adenoma
